Upbound Group said it recently experienced a cybersecurity incident in which customer information and documents were obtained without authorization.
The owner of Rent-A-Center and Brigit said it believes the obtained information was subsequently used to facilitate fraudulent lease-to-own agreements. As a result, Upbound expects its Acima business to report elevated fraudulent contract losses of about $13 million during the second quarter.
Upbound said its investigation of the incident remains ongoing, but at this time, the company believes the incident wasn't material.
Upbound quickly began implementing mitigation and remediation measures upon learning of the breach, working with external cybersecurity experts to enhance authentication controls and to implement additional fraud detection and monitoring capabilities, the company said. It additionally notified federal law enforcement, it said.
